How Common Is The Last Name Culleney? popularity and diffusion
The last name Culleney is the 2,909,720th most frequently held surname internationally It is held by approximately 1 in 161,945,465 people. The surname Culleney is primarily found in The Americas, where 78 percent of Culleney live; 78 percent live in North America and 78 percent live in Anglo-North America.
Culleney is most frequently used in The United States, where it is borne by 36 people, or 1 in 10,068,304. In The United States it is mostly concentrated in: California, where 28 percent live, Pennsylvania, where 28 percent live and Delaware, where 22 percent live. Barring The United States this surname occurs in one country. It is also found in Australia, where 20 percent live.
